How to maintain consistent numeric rounding and aggregation rules within ELT to prevent reporting discrepancies across datasets.
Ensuring uniform rounding and aggregation in ELT pipelines safeguards reporting accuracy across diverse datasets, reducing surprises during dashboards, audits, and strategic decision-making.
July 29, 2025
Facebook X Reddit
In modern data environments, ETL and ELT processes move from raw data toward reliable, analysis-ready information. The challenge is not merely collecting numbers but applying consistent numerical rules across many sources. When rounding happens differently in source systems, staging layers, and dashboards, tiny discrepancies compound into noticeable misstatements in totals, averages, and growth rates. A disciplined approach starts with explicit rounding policies: decide where rounding occurs, what precision is required, and how to handle edge cases such as ties or negative values. Codify these rules into reusable components so every dataset adheres to the same standard, regardless of origin or load path.
Establishing a single source of truth for rounding policies is essential. Teams should publish a formal rounding matrix that maps data domains to their required precision, the rounding function (round, floor, ceiling, bankers rounding), and any special behaviors for nulls or missing values. This matrix becomes a reference for developers, analysts, and data stewards, eliminating ad hoc decisions at pull or transform moments. By treating rounding rules as first-class metadata, you enable automatic validation, documentation, and impact analysis whenever a dataset is modified. The result is predictability in numerical outputs across reports and platforms.
Harmonize numerical rules by centralizing control and validation mechanisms.
Aggregation rules, like rounding, must be consistent not only within a dataset but across the entire data landscape. Decide in advance which aggregation level drives totals: sum, average, count distinct, or weighted measures. Align these choices with business definitions to avoid mismatches in KPI calculations. When two datasets contribute to a single metric, ensure both apply the same rounding and have equivalent grouping keys. Document the logic behind each aggregate function and expose it in the data catalog. This transparency makes it easier to diagnose discrepancies and fosters trust among stakeholders who rely on the numbers for critical decisions.
ADVERTISEMENT
ADVERTISEMENT
Implementing consistent aggregation requires shared tooling and governance. Create reusable ETL/ELT components that encapsulate rounding and aggregation logic, allowing teams to reuse tested code rather than reinventing the wheel. Unit tests should cover typical, boundary, and error scenarios, including very large or very small values, negative numbers, and nulls. Data lineage tracking helps identify where a rounding decision propagates through the pipeline. Automating the preservation of original granularity alongside derived metrics prevents late-stage surprises when reports or dashboards are refreshed, ensuring analysts can audit each step.
Build a testable, auditable framework for rounding and aggregation decisions.
Data pipelines often integrate sources with different numeric conventions, such as currencies, percentages, or physics measurements. A harmonization strategy is needed to ensure that all numbers conform to a shared representation before any aggregation occurs. This includes standardizing unit scales (e.g., thousands vs. units) and applying consistent decimal precision. A centralized layer should perform unit normalization, followed by rounding per the policy, before data moves toward the fact tables. When new sources join the ecosystem, they should inherit the established rounding and aggregation rules automatically unless there is a documented, business-approved exception.
ADVERTISEMENT
ADVERTISEMENT
Validation processes must accompany the centralization effort. Automated checks compare computed metrics against a trusted reference during each load, flagging deviations caused by rounding inconsistencies. Alerting should include enough context to locate the source: the dataset, the transform, and the precise operation that produced the divergence. Periodic reconciliation exercises with business users help verify that numeric expectations align with reality. By embedding validation into the ELT cycle, teams catch problems earlier, reduce manual correction time, and maintain confidence in the reported figures.
Embed governance and automation to sustain consistent numeric behavior.
A robust testing framework evaluates how rounding behaves under a spectrum of conditions. Tests should simulate normal data, edge cases, and performance-heavy scenarios to observe how precision and aggregation hold up as data volume grows. Include tests for tied values, negative numbers, zero handling, and null propagation. Ensure tests verify both the numeric result and the metadata describing the applied rule. The goal is to detect not only incorrect outputs but also silent rule drift. A well-documented test suite makes refactoring safer and supports continuous delivery of data pipelines without compromising accuracy.
Documentation plays a critical role in sustaining consistency. Publish clear guidelines on rounding strategy, aggregation choices, and their impact on downstream metrics. Include diagrams illustrating data flow, decision points, and where rules are applied. Provide examples showing how identical inputs yield identical outputs across different paths within the ELT. Encourage feedback from analysts who routinely interpret dashboards, because their insights can reveal nuanced interpretations of numeric results that may demand rule refinements over time.
ADVERTISEMENT
ADVERTISEMENT
Reconcile historical data with ongoing rule enforcement and future-proofing.
Governance ensures that rounding and aggregation policies survive personnel changes and evolving requirements. Establish roles such as data stewards, data engineers, and policy owners who review rule updates, approve exceptions, and oversee the change control process. A formal change log helps track when and why a rule was modified, enabling accurate audit trails. Automation can enforce policy across pipelines, preventing ad-hoc deviations by gating deployments with checks that verify consistency. This governance framework reduces the risk of unintentional inconsistencies as data environments scale and diversify.
Automation complements governance by providing real-time enforcement. Integrate policy checks into the deployment pipeline so that any change triggers validation against the rounding and aggregation rules. If a transformation attempts to apply a different precision or a divergent aggregation, the pipeline should halt with a descriptive error. Such safeguards promote disciplined development while giving data teams confidence that outputs remain aligned with established standards, even as new sources and transformations are introduced.
Historical data presents a unique challenge because past reports may reflect rounding decisions that no longer apply. A migration plan should address legacy values by either reprocessing historical records under the current rules (when feasible) or annotating results with the exact rules used at the time of computation. Both approaches require careful coordination between data owners and product teams. Document how retroactive changes affect dashboards and governance metrics, and communicate any implications to stakeholders who rely on longitudinal analyses. The aim is to maintain continuity while enabling evolution toward more rigorous numeric standards.
When the ELT environment achieves tight, universal rounding and aggregation controls, reporting discrepancies diminish substantially. Stakeholders gain trust in the numbers, and analysts can explore datasets with confidence that comparisons are valid. Teams will still handle exceptions for legitimate business needs, but these are managed through formal processes rather than improvised changes. A mature approach blends policy, tooling, validation, governance, and documentation into a cohesive, auditable system. In the end, consistent numeric rules empower better decisions across the organization, even as data sources grow more complex.
Related Articles
Coordinating multi-team ELT releases requires structured governance, clear ownership, and automated safeguards that align data changes with downstream effects, minimizing conflicts, race conditions, and downtime across shared pipelines.
August 04, 2025
Legacy data integration demands a structured, cross-functional approach that minimizes risk, preserves data fidelity, and enables smooth migration to scalable, future-ready ETL pipelines without interrupting ongoing operations or compromising stakeholder trust.
August 07, 2025
Building durable, auditable ELT pipelines requires disciplined versioning, clear lineage, and automated validation to ensure consistent analytics outcomes and compliant regulatory reporting over time.
August 07, 2025
Designing resilient upstream backfills requires disciplined lineage, precise scheduling, and integrity checks to prevent cascading recomputation while preserving accurate results across evolving data sources.
July 15, 2025
Establish a sustainable, automated charm checks and linting workflow that covers ELT SQL scripts, YAML configurations, and ancillary configuration artifacts, ensuring consistency, quality, and maintainability across data pipelines with scalable tooling, clear standards, and automated guardrails.
July 26, 2025
As data ecosystems mature, teams seek universal ELT abstractions that sit above engines, coordinate workflows, and expose stable APIs, enabling scalable integration, simplified governance, and consistent data semantics across platforms.
July 19, 2025
A comprehensive guide examines policy-driven retention rules, automated archival workflows, and governance controls designed to optimize ELT pipelines while ensuring compliance, efficiency, and scalable data lifecycle management.
July 18, 2025
Building a robust revision-controlled transformation catalog integrates governance, traceability, and rollback-ready logic across data pipelines, ensuring change visibility, auditable history, and resilient, adaptable ETL and ELT processes for complex environments.
July 16, 2025
When building cross platform ETL pipelines, choosing the appropriate serialization format is essential for performance, compatibility, and future scalability. This article guides data engineers through a practical, evergreen evaluation framework that transcends specific tooling while remaining actionable across varied environments.
July 28, 2025
Successful collaborative data engineering hinges on shared pipelines, disciplined code reviews, transparent governance, and scalable orchestration that empower diverse teams to ship reliable data products consistently.
August 03, 2025
An evergreen guide outlining resilient ELT pipeline architecture that accommodates staged approvals, manual checkpoints, and auditable interventions to ensure data quality, compliance, and operational control across complex data environments.
July 19, 2025
Organizations running multiple ELT pipelines can face bottlenecks when they contend for shared artifacts or temporary tables. Efficient dependency resolution requires thoughtful orchestration, robust lineage tracking, and disciplined artifact naming. By designing modular ETL components and implementing governance around artifact lifecycles, teams can minimize contention, reduce retries, and improve throughput without sacrificing correctness. The right strategy blends scheduling, caching, metadata, and access control to sustain performance as data platforms scale. This article outlines practical approaches, concrete patterns, and proven practices to keep ELT dependencies predictable, auditable, and resilient across diverse pipelines.
July 18, 2025
Effective validation of metrics derived from ETL processes builds confidence in dashboards, enabling data teams to detect anomalies, confirm data lineage, and sustain decision-making quality across rapidly changing business environments.
July 27, 2025
In modern ELT workflows, establishing consistent data type coercion rules is essential for trustworthy aggregation results, because subtle mismatches in casting can silently distort summaries, groupings, and analytics conclusions over time.
August 08, 2025
Metadata-driven ETL frameworks offer scalable governance, reduce redundancy, and accelerate data workflows by enabling consistent definitions, automated lineage, and reusable templates that empower diverse teams to collaborate without stepping on one another’s toes.
August 09, 2025
Designing ELT logs requires balancing detailed provenance with performance, selecting meaningful events, structured formats, and noise reduction techniques to support efficient debugging without overwhelming storage resources.
August 08, 2025
This evergreen guide explains practical, repeatable deployment gates and canary strategies that protect ELT pipelines, ensuring data integrity, reliability, and measurable risk control before any production rollout.
July 24, 2025
This guide explains practical, scalable methods to detect cost anomalies, flag runaway ELT processes, and alert stakeholders before cloud budgets spiral, with reproducible steps and templates.
July 30, 2025
This evergreen guide outlines practical, scalable approaches to aligning analytics, engineering, and product teams through well-defined runbooks, incident cadences, and collaborative decision rights during ETL disruptions and data quality crises.
July 25, 2025
Designing ELT governance that nurtures fast data innovation while enforcing security, privacy, and compliance requires clear roles, adaptive policies, scalable tooling, and ongoing collaboration across stakeholders.
July 28, 2025